Meaning of

anqareeb

अनक़रीब • انقریب

soon; shortly

जल्द; शीघ्र

جلد; عنقریب

Arabic

Anqareeb carries a sense of anticipation and the imminence of an event. In poetry, it often evokes the tension between the present and the near future, where hopes and fears intermingle.

Poets often use anqareeb to express the imminence of change or the arrival of a long-awaited moment. It can also highlight the fragility of time, where moments slip quickly into the past.
